  • Annual Deck and Patio Checkup: A Simple Homeowner Routine
    2026/06/25

    In this episode of Deck Builders Los Angeles, we finish season three with a practical yearly checkup routine for decks and patios. Instead of waiting for something to break, we show you how a short, once‑a‑year walkthrough can catch small issues early and keep your outdoor spaces safe and looking good. This is designed for everyday homeowners, not inspectors, and works for both wood and composite decks plus most patio setups.

    We walk you through a simple path: start at the stairs and railings, then move across the surface, and finally look underneath or around the edges where possible. You’ll learn what to look and feel for, including soft spots, loose boards, wobbly railings, rusted hardware, and signs of movement at posts or landings. We also talk about surface issues like peeling finishes, mold or algae buildup, and clogged gaps or joints that can trap water. For composite decks, including those built with brands like TimberTech or Fiberon, we explain how cleaning and inspection needs differ slightly from wood, but still matter for long‑term performance.

    From there, we tie the checklist to simple maintenance actions: cleaning, sealing or staining wood where needed, tightening connections, and deciding when it’s time to bring in a professional for deeper repairs or replacement planning. We also touch on planning small upgrades during this checkup, like adding step lights, improving drainage near downspouts, or adjusting furniture layouts to protect high‑wear areas.

  • Deck Replacement: When Repair Isn’t Enough
    2026/06/16

    In this episode of Deck Builders Los Angeles, we talk about deck replacement and how to tell when repairs are no longer the safest or most cost‑effective option. Many older decks around Los Angeles still look okay at first glance, but have hidden issues in framing, posts, or connections that you only see once you look underneath. We explain the warning signs and what a professional builder looks for during an evaluation.

    You’ll hear about common problems like rotted posts, undersized beams, loose or rusted hardware, and poor ledger connections at the house. We discuss how climate, age, and past maintenance all affect whether a deck can be safely repaired or should be rebuilt from the frame up. On the material side, we talk about why some homeowners use replacement as a chance to switch from older wood surfaces to composite decking from brands like Trex or Fiberon for lower long‑term maintenance.

    We also walk through what a replacement project typically includes: demolition, disposal, new framing built to current standards, new railings and stairs, and any layout changes that make the space easier to use. You’ll learn why deck replacement is a good time to adjust size, shape, and access points so the new structure fits how you actually live today, not how the home was used decades ago.
